#664128 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#664128 is composed of 40% red, 25.5% green and 15.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 36.3% magenta, 60.8% yellow and 60% black. It has a hue angle of 24.2 degrees, a saturation of 43.7% and a lightness of 27.8%. #664128 color hex could be obtained by blending #cc8250 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663333.

● #664128 color description : Very dark orange [Brown tone].
#664128 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#664128 has RGB values of R:102, G:65, B:40 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.36, Y:0.61, K:0.6. Its decimal value is 6701352.
